Before you start
How to measure.
You'll need a soft tape measure and ideally another person to help. Wear close-fitting clothing, not the gear you'll be measuring for.
-
Chest
Around the fullest part of your chest, under the armpits, with the tape parallel to the ground.
-
Bust (women's)
Around the fullest part of your bust, with the tape parallel to the ground and not too tight.
-
Natural Waist (for tops)
Around the narrowest part of your torso, usually just above the belly button.
-
Waist (for jeans)
Around where you actually wear your jeans, usually lower than your natural waist, around the hips.
-
Hips
Around the fullest part of your hips and seat, with the tape parallel to the ground.
-
Inseam
From your crotch down the inside of your leg to the floor, in bare feet or socks.
-
Sleeve
From the centre back of your neck, across your shoulder, down to your wrist with your arm slightly bent.
-
Body Length (for t-shirts & hoodies)
From the highest point of the shoulder, straight down to the hem of the garment.

02 · Riding Jeans · Men's
The Riding Jeans.
Cut as a straight-leg riding jean with reinforced panels and armour pockets at the knees and hips. The waist sits where you'd expect a standard pair of jeans to sit.
The knee armour has two positions to align with your riding posture, which is higher than your knee when standing.
| Size | Waist | Hip | Inseam (S / R / L) |
|---|---|---|---|
| 28 | 28" | 35" | 30 / 32 / 34" |
| 30 | 30" | 37" | 30 / 32 / 34" |
| 32 | 32" | 39" | 30 / 32 / 34" |
| 34 | 34" | 41" | 30 / 32 / 34" |
| 36 | 36" | 43" | 30 / 32 / 34" |
| 38 | 38" | 45" | 30 / 32 / 34" |
| 40 | 40" | 47" | 30 / 32 / 34" |
Fit guidance
The waist size matches your standard jeans size. If you wear a 32 in regular denim, order a 32 here. The cut sits straight through the leg, neither skinny nor relaxed.
The knee armour should sit just above your kneecap when you're seated in your normal riding position. Adjust the armour between the high and low pockets to line it up.
Between sizes: size up. Riding jeans need to be comfortable in the riding position, which compresses the waist and stretches the legs.
